Sorting and Grouping
Recognize and differentiate between big and little objects
Sort objects into groups based on size
Develop observation and classification skills

Gather objects and introduce today's BibleMouse sorting adventure
Introduce big and little concepts with simple explanations
Use two baskets to sort objects by size
Simpler: Help child sort objects, using hand-over-hand guidance
Challenge: Time the sorting, make it a fun race
Review sorting activity and celebrate learning
